Does this help?:

  • right click on a model file
  • select “Open With…”
  • search for SketchUp in the dialog that follows. Keep the “Always use this program…” box ticked
  • click OK

The cause of your thumbnails not showing mostly because of you recently just installed newer, older, or different version of sketchup into your PC.

You’ll choose “Repair”.

Very good…I solved it…
Relaunched the setup installation of Sketchup, performed the repair…
Icons are returned to view correctly…
The added plugins have remained in place, you do not need to reload them…
